The stage is set for an epic conclusion to the Oklahoma high school football season as the undefeated Bixby Spartans (12-0) face the Owasso Rams (10-2) in Saturday night’s Class 6A-I state championship game in Edmond.

The OU offense finally gets in some rhythm. A 27-yard pass to JaVonnie Gibson helped OU get close to the red zone. Kicker Tate Sandell hit his 23rd straight field goal to put the Sooners ahead 3-0. 4:31 left in the 1st quarter.

The championship has come down to the Choctaw Yellowjackets vs. the Sand Springs Sandites. Choctaw is the defending champion, while Sand Springs hasn’t lost a game since Sept. 12. Opening kickoff is set for 7 p.m. CT on Friday, December 5 in Edmond, Okla., with a live TV broadcast on NFHS Network.
